Subject: Handover — validator plugin stuff

Hey Priya,

Passing you the baton on Checkwright, our plugin system for data validators. The new schema-drift plugin shipped Tuesday and mostly behaves, but it occasionally flags empty CSV uploads as "malformed" — harmless, just noisy. I've muted the alert until Friday. If support escalates anything about plugin load failures, the fix is usually bumping the registry cache. Questions after I'm off? Reach the Checkwright maintainers at the address below.

billing contact of hawip-kahif = zorwyn@tolvaqlabs.corp

Subject: Handover — GraphQL N+1 fix in Orderline API

Team, the dataloader batching fix that resolved the N+1 queries on the Orderline schema shipped last sprint. Maintenance of the resolver layer, including the batching cache and its eviction settings, is moving off my plate as I rotate to the Lanternfish platform team. Any regressions in query counts should be flagged early. Ongoing ownership sits with the person named below.

named custodian: Brivan Eliath Quenox Frador

**Mgmt Meeting Minutes — Retiring the Brightline Range**

Quick recap for sales leads at Fenholt Supplies: we agreed to retire the Brightline fixture range by year-end. Remaining stock moves to clearance pricing next month, and accounts on standing orders get migrated to the Lumetta range. Trade-in incentives were approved in principle. The confidential note on next steps sits just below.

board note of bajof-bajeg: The pricing group signed off on a budget of $13.4 million for Project Sildor. The renewal with Lamixek Holdings closes at $48.9 million a year, 49 percent above the last contract.

Ticket: FERN-2241 — Connection failures after image slimming

After slimming the Fernbright worker image, containers fail DB connections on startup. Root cause: the slim base dropped the CA bundle, so TLS handshakes to the orders database fail. Fix in flight: reinstall certs in the build stage. Release manager: hold the 4.2 cut until this lands. To reproduce against staging, connect using the string below:

primary connection of yagep-kahip = redis://giliel_svc:zYiKsLL2PLpfPL@db-348f.xolmarsys.corp:5432/fenwyn